I love Troon north, but it is not far and away the best course. I don’t like the Phoenician since the redesign as they removed some of the better hole IMO.

Eagle Mtn is cool, but I would really recommend We Ko Pa cholla course for a true desert golf experience. No houses on the course and you must book by calling them or on their website. Sun Ridge Canyon is also another cool desert course that is very challenging.

ETA-disclaimer I think both the TPC courses are way overrated and tourist traps. Way better golf is available for much better prices. I really try to talk everyone out of playing those overpriced, overrated dumps. It pisses me off they continue to get away with the prices they charge.
